George Lucas' Original Treatment for the Star Wars Sequels
Posted on 12/16/17 at 1:28 am
Posted on 12/16/17 at 1:28 am
LINK
The following were all in Lucas' outline:
Kira (Rey/Thea) as a scavenger on a desert planet.
Skylar/Finn/Sam as Kira's friend.
Kira finding a "map" to Luke Skywalker by the end of the film.
Luke being in hiding somewhere and dealing with some heavy emotional issues.
The nebulous concept of the Jedi Killer (Talon as Jedi Killer is just one possibility, the earliest Jedi Killer art really changes the appearance up, from non-human to human to Talon to Knight of Ren looking dude, to perhaps even Snoke himself.
Han Solo was back to his smuggling ways.
Leia was in a position of power.
The Neo-Empire was a thing (just not called First Order yet).
There was a "shadowy puppeteer" behind Talon/the Jedi Killer.
A final confrontation between Rey/Thea/Kira and the "Jedi Killer" on an snow planet.
The Neo-Empire having a superweapon.
A Yoda-like creature to move the story along (eventually Maz).
A graveyard of imperial stuff on various planets, including Jakku.
A forest planet w/ a castle (what eventually becomes Maz's stronghold).
A green planet with a WWII style "Republic base."
Kira/Rey/Thea living in an AT-AT.
Again, lots and lots of pictures of Kira/Rey/Thea wandering the junkyards of her world and being a gearhead/techie/scavenger.
Luke's hiding spot was always either an island or a forest planet that was gorgeous.
quote:
The map to Luke wasn't always just a chip from LST and in R2. At one point Rey would find R2 on Jakku and the map would be in R2, at another point the Falcon would go underwater and find the crashed debris of the Emperor's throne room that would contain the map.
quote:
The Republic had a superweapon at one point. It was a big-arse death-star sized ship that rammed planetary shields and then deployed its ships within the shields, basically a big shield breaker. This is bad arse, and would have been way cooler to see than Han's "refresh rate" maneuver with the Falcon and then a battle between like a dozen X-Wings and apparently the same # of TIE fighters on a planet that's supposed to be entirely a military installation.
